Find f(−1) given that f(x)=x3+2x2+3x+4. <br>A. 10 <br>B. -2 <br>C. 2 <br>D. -10
Finger [1]

Answer:

The answer is option C

Step-by-step explanation:

f(x) = x³ + 2x² + 3x + 4

To find f(-1) substitute the value of x that's

- 1 into f(x)

That's

<h3>f( - 1) =  ({ - 1})^{3}  + 2 ({ - 1})^{2}  + 3( - 1) + 4 \\  =  - 1 + 2(1)  - 3 + 4 \\  =  - 1 + 2 - 3 + 4 \\  = 1 - 3 + 4</h3>

We have the final answer as

<h3>f( - 1) = 2</h3>
